    Study Notes

    Monetary Management

    • The Bangko Sentral ng Pilipinas (BSP) manages monetary aggregates to maintain price stability.
    • When abnormal movements in monetary aggregates, credit, or prices endanger the economy, the Monetary Board takes action to address the situation.

    Monetary Board Report

    • The Monetary Board submits a detailed report to the President and Congress, which includes an assessment of the monetary policy and its impact on the economy.
    • The report is submitted on a regular basis, usually every six months.

    Monetary Policy Objectives

    • The main objective of the Monetary Board's actions is to maintain price stability and promote a low inflation environment.
    • The Monetary Board aims to achieve this objective by managing monetary aggregates, credit, and prices.
